adverb
- used to say that something good happened or that something bad was avoided
Usage: sentence adverb
Examples
- Fortunately, the weather cleared up just before the picnic.
- I forgot my umbrella, but fortunately it didn’t rain.
- The accident looked serious, but fortunately no one was hurt.
- Fortunately for us, the store was still open when we arrived.
- She missed her flight, but fortunately there was another one an hour later.
- The test was difficult, but fortunately I had studied hard.
- Fortunately, the doctor said the injury would heal quickly.
